My son has these two trees and neither one of them is doing well. The "Tea tree" has wilted, turning brown leaves that look like the fluid has been drained and it has "white bumps" on the leaves. I think I have seen spider mites, at least one, but no webbing on anything. Looks like a fungal issue as well.
The other tree, "Rain Tree" has similar leaves looking drained and starting to drop. Some of the branches look like they are dying, and are brown.
I was reading that the Tea Tree needs humidity and high light for 14-16 hrs a day.
Any help will be very appreciated, as I don't know much about these bonsai. Was thinking about getting some Neem Oil.
